Underwater Turbine Tested Successfully In Scotland



scotland tidal turbine
Scottish Power Renewables (SPR) is reported to have completed testing period of ‘Hammerfest Strom HS 1000’ an immersed tidal power turbine near the island of Eday. This HS 1000 comes with integrated blades that are pretty short. It is to produce one-megawatt of electricity for the buildings on Eday, and to be monitored by engineers of the European Marine Energy Center and inspected from Glasgow with the help of mobile connection and an on-board camera.
